Key Buying Factors for a Hotel Commercial Filtered Water Dispenser
Filtration Performance
Look for systems that address the water concerns most relevant to your property, such as chlorine taste, sediment, lead, and PFAS reduction. Multi-stage filtration or reverse osmosis can improve water quality, but they may increase maintenance needs.
Flow Rate and Capacity
Hotels with steady foot traffic should pay close attention to output speed and recovery time. A dispenser that works well for a small boutique property may feel underpowered in a larger lobby or conference area.
Installation Style
In-wall and surface-mount units save space and create a polished appearance, while bottleless coolers and countertop dispensers are more flexible. Make sure your plumbing, electrical access, and drainage match the model you choose.
Guest Experience and Accessibility
Hands-free activation, clear controls, and ADA-friendly designs help improve usability for a wider range of guests. Temperature options also matter: room temp is practical, cold is expected, and hot water can be a nice value-add in premium areas.
Maintenance and Serviceability
Choose a unit with easy filter access, clear service intervals, and a design your team can clean quickly. Self-cleaning features can reduce labor, but only if they fit your long-term maintenance plan.
Who Should Buy Which Hotel Commercial Filtered Water Dispenser?
If you want a clean architectural look, choose an in-wall or surface-mount dispenser. If flexibility and faster setup matter more, a bottleless cooler or countertop system is usually the better fit. For higher-traffic hotels, prioritize refrigerated output, strong filtration, and durable stainless steel construction. For boutique and premium properties, a quiet, hands-free model with hot and cold options may deliver the best guest impression.
In short, the best Hotel Commercial Filtered Water Dispenser is the one that matches your traffic level, space constraints, and service goals without creating extra work for your staff.
